Etymology

[edit]

From inpetō (rush upon, attack) +‎ -bilis (-able).

Pronunciation

[edit]

Adjective

[edit]

inpetibilis (neuter inpetibile); third-declension two-termination adjective

  1. Alternative form of impetibilis
